"Jux-ta-po-si-tions Volume II" contains a little over 100 haiku and senryu on 60 pages. Both are modem English short verse forms without rhyme or meter and claim Japanese origin. In its strictest form, haiku relate Nature and human behavioral characteristics. Senryu are more about human nature and foibles. Whatever you call them, they provide unique opportunity to express momentary experiences, observations and reflections. They tend to rise up at unexpected times from the inner self in succinct, surprising form. They are super companions. For example, a remark from the shoe repair man, "No deposit necessary, you're from the old school" prompted 75-I ought to just sit and rock and, can you remember when your four year old came home from nursery school with the news that Jimmy has chicken pox? pre-school treat -chicken pox for everyone! Life is full of surprises. Therefore, "Jux-ta-po-si-tions Volume II" is a celebration of life.
